English Daily Vocabulary from THE HINDU – Episode 251 – December 16th, 2017

1. Floundered Class : Verb Meaning : struggle or stagger helplessly or clumsily in water or mud.. Synonyms: stumble, struggle Antonyms : succeed, grow Example Sentences Some component firms prospered but many more specialist car component enterprises floundered . If the deer had floundered , she’d have gone into the water herself. 2. Botch Class

